General Description

The Cultural Programs Temporary Theater Technicians are responsible for performing a variety of duties in support of users of the OCCC Bruce Owen Theater ( BOT ) and Visual Performing Arts Center Theater ( VPACT ). The work includes assisting college and outside patrons with light, sound, and on-stage requirements. This requires the technician to have a flexible schedule and be available to work days, evenings and/or weekends as required by theater usage requests.

Physical Demands/Working Conditions

GENERAL P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S :
Very heavy work: This position requires the person to occasionally exert up to 100 pounds of force and constantly exert up to 50 pounds of force to move theater sound and lighting equipment and assist with stage set-up.
PHYSICAL ACTIVITIES :
This position requires the person to frequently move about the various theater and stage locations and occasionally perform job functions in narrow aisles or passageways.
This position requires the person to frequently communicate with and listen to internal and external constituents to perform the essential functions of the position. Must be able to exchange accurate information in various situations.
This position requires the person to occasionally remain in a standing and stationary position.
This position requires the person to constantly operate theater sound and lighting equipment that frequently involves repetitive motions of hands and wrists.
This position requires the person to frequently ascend/descend a ladder to service theater sound and lighting.
This position requires the person to frequently position self to move, lift or work on theater and stage equipment.
VISUAL ACUITY :
This position requires the person to detect, determine, observe and assess the accuracy and thoroughness of equipment and lighting placement. Must assess the accuracy of the stage set-up.
WORKING CONDITIONS :
This position’s essential functions are constantly performed in indoor conditions and is frequently performed in outside conditions.
This position requires the person to frequently be exposed to fumes, odors, dusts and gases associated with a theater and stage area.
This position requires the person to occasionally wear a respirator mask.

Job Duties (Duties Assignment Statement)

Conduct the operation, handling, and safe usage of the rigging, lighting, and sound systems in the OCCC Bruce Owen Theater ( BOT ) and Visual and Performing Arts Center Theater ( VPACT ).
Professionally assist each theater user/user group with their event requirements to assure the success of the event while adhering to the Theater Guidelines.
Plan and carry to completion specific assignments and reports.
Interact with the public and college personnel in a professional manner.
Other duties as assigned by the Stage Manager or Assistant Stage Manager.
